How does the study method work?

Each topic is broken into short, interactive slide-based lessons (typically 8–15 slides). Each slide combines a concept, a visual, a memory hook, an operational-relevance note, and a check-understanding question gate. Wrong answers show explanations so you learn from the mistake. Quick Revision pulls out key facts, must-know items, and exam traps; SM-2 spaced-repetition flashcards surface what you’re about to forget; timed quizzes verify retention. Progress saves automatically across devices.
